This new decal sheet from Zotz Decals includes markings for 3 different P-51D Mustangs including one with sexy cowgirl noseart.

  • P-51D-20-NA, 44-72505 "The Flying Undertaker - Snooks 6th" flown by Major William "Bill" A, Shomo, 82nd TRS, April 1945, Bimally Philippines.  Overall natural metal with yellow spinner and black stripes on rear of fuselage.

  • P-51D-10-NA, 44-14570 flown by Capt. Ted E Lines, of the 335th FS 4th FG.  Overall natural metal with red spinner and artwork of Navajo Thunderbird with victories identified as arrowheads.

  • P-51D-10-NA, 44-14111, "Straw Boss 2 - Little Sandra", flown by Lt. Col. James D Mayden based at A-84 Chievres Belgium, from mid March to april 1945.  Overall natural metal with blue nose and red rudder and pilots daughter name on starboard side of the nose.

The decals are contained on 1 decal sheet and contains all the special markings for these aircraft.  You get one set of national insignia and the stencils you can source from the decal sheet that will come with your model.  The printing quality is first rate and the decals are very crisply printed.

Zotz Decals has included 3 great P-51's on this decal sheet and all 3 of them are sporting some sort of artwork....which will make it very difficult to decide which one to build first.
